Sudeep Pharma Reports Strong Q4FY26 Results, Maintains Growth Momentum

Sudeep Pharma has reported its consolidated revenue for the fourth quarter of fiscal year 2026 (Q4FY26) at Rs1.8 billion, marking a significant growth of 16% year-over-year (YoY) and 6% quarter-over-quarter (QoQ). The company's revenue for the entire fiscal year 2026 (FY26) increased by a substantial 28% YoY to Rs6.4 billion.

The Specialty Ingredients (SI) segment was a key driver of growth, with revenue rising by 105% YoY and 26% QoQ, largely due to higher demand across infant nutrition, medical nutrition, and dietary supplements. The SI business contributed around 44% to FY26 revenue, while EBIT margins remained largely stable.

In contrast, the Pharmaceutical, Food & Nutrition (PFN) segment experienced a decline of 20% YoY and 9% QoQ. However, management expects EBITDA growth of approximately 15% in the PFN business over the fiscal years 2027 and 2028, supported by higher capacity utilization.

The company's pCAM project remains on track for Phase-1 commissioning by April 2027, driven by rising global demand and China+1 sourcing opportunities. Management has guided FY27 EBITDA margins of around 37%, while inventory levels are expected to remain high to support customer demand and ensure raw material availability.

Outlook and Valuation

The commissioning of the PFN expansion has been delayed due to customer validation timelines, which are expected to take around 6-12 months. The stock is currently trading at 35x FY28E EPS, while we value the company at 33x FY28E EPS. Based on this analysis, we maintain our 'Reduce' rating with a target price of Rs627.
